Does the Radio de Dos Vías Caltta Dm660 work with other walkie talkies?
Like most Hytera radios, this one talks to any other radio on the same frequency band and mode. If both units are analog and share the band, they will hear each other even across brands. Digital-only modes will not interop, so keep that in mind if you are mixing fleets.
Do I need a license to use the Radio de Dos Vías Caltta Dm660?
It depends on the band. FRS radios need no license in the US, while GMRS requires a $35 family license from the FCC. If the model is a commercial or amateur radio, a license or a business frequency is required. When in doubt, check the frequency range printed on the back label.
